what is the difference between drift current and diffusion
current.
Answer Posted / krishna
Drift current is the net flow of carrier due to applied
potential in p type or n type material.
While diffusion current occur due to concentration
gradient and it is responcible for current flow across the
junction(minority carrier diffusion).
